Dark Lilac vs Royal Indigo
Dark Lilac is a Benjamin Moore color while Royal Indigo comes from PPG. Hue-wise, Dark Lilac belongs to the blue-purple family and Royal Indigo to the purple family. At LRV 10 vs 7, Dark Lilac will read as the brighter of the two — a 3-point gap that matters most in north-facing or low-light rooms. At ΔE 4.8, the difference is perceptible but not dramatic — the two can work harmoniously in the same space.
